The Management Board of PGE Polska Grupa Energetyczna S.A. (“PGE”, “Company”) informs that on May 30, 2012 the Ordinary General Meeting of the Company adopted resolutions on:
* appointment of Mr. Marcin Zieliński to the Supervisory Board as of May 31, 2012 and entrusting him the position of the Chairman of the Supervisory Board,
* appointment of the following persons to the Supervisory Board as of May 31, 2012 and entrusting them the position of the member of the Supervisory Board:
- Mr. Maciej Bałtowski
- Mr. Jacek Barylski
- Mrs. Małgorzata Dec
- Mr. Czesław Grzesiak
- Mr. Grzegorz Krystek
- Mrs. Katarzyna Prus
Mr. Marcin Zieliński graduated from the Law and Administration Faculty at the University of Warsaw and postgraduate studies in finance at the Warsaw School of Economics. In 2003-2004 attended legislative professional training.
As of 2008, Mr. Marcin Zieliński has been the Director of the Ownership Supervision and Privatization III and currently is a Director of Privatization Department in the Ministry of State Treasury.
From May 2009, until February 2010 Vice-Chairman of the Supervisory Board at PHZ Baltona S.A. From May 2010, until September 2010, member of the Supervisory Board at Nordis Chłodnie Polskie Sp. z o.o. Former member of the supervisory boards at Stocznia Gdynia S.A and Elektrownia Zarnowiec S.A. Chairman of the Supervisory Boards in Electra Deutshland GmbH.
According to the submitted statement, Mr. Marcin Zieliński is affiliated with a shareholder holding shares representing not less than 5% of all voting rights at the General Meeting i.e. with State Treasury through employment at the Ministry of State Treasury.

Mrs. Magorzata Dec holds PhD in economics. Graduate of the Warsaw School of Economics. Currently holds the position of the Director of Research Department at the Ministry of State Treasury, member of the Supervisory Board of Huta Pokój S.A., former President of the Supervisory Board of RUCH S.A, Nafta Polska S.A., member of supervisory boards at Polskie Radio – Regional division Radio Gdansk S.A., Nordis Chłodnie Polskie Sp. z o.o., and Warszawski Rolno – Spożywczy Rynek Hurtowy S.A. According to the submitted statement, Ms. Małgorzata Dec is affiliated with a shareholder holding shares representing not less than 5% of all voting rights at General Meeting i.e. with State Treasury through employment at the Ministry of State Treasury.

Mrs. Katarzyna Prus graduated from the Law and Administration Faculty at the University of Warsaw. Legal Advisor.
As of 1996 Mrs. Katarzyna Prus has worked in the Ministry of the State Treasury, currently Head of the Legal and Litigation Department. As of 2001 Ms. Katarzyna Prus has been appointed to the examination board for candidates to supervisory boards in State Treasury companies.
Former chairman of the supervisory boards at Zespół Elektrociepłowni Poznańskich S.A., Uzdrowisko “Lądek-Długopole” S.A., Przedsiębiorstwo Spedycji Międzynarodowej C. Hartwig-Katowice S.A. and member of the Supervisory Board of Południowy Koncern Energetyczny S.A. As of 2006 Mrs. Katarzyna Prus has held the position of Member, then Chairman of the Supervisory Board of Fabryka Elementów Złącznych S.A..
According to the submitted statement, Ms. Katarzyna Prus is affiliated with a shareholder holding shares representing not less than 5% of all voting rights at the General Meeting with State Treasury through employment at the Ministry of State Treasury.

Mr. Maciej Bałtowski is a full professor at the Faculty of Economics at the Maria Curie-Skłodowska University in Lublin. Author of numerous studies on issues related to transformation of the Polish economy and privatization, operation of privatized enterprises and ownership supervision exercised by the State. In years 2001-2003 expert of the Parliamentary State Treasury Committee. Co-author of several projects related to the amendment of the Privatization Act. Former Chairman of supervisory boards at: Wschodni Bank Cukrownictwa S.A., Lubelska Fabryka Wag FAWAG S.A., and Miejskie Przedsiębiorstwo Wodociągów i Kanalizacji Sp. z o.o. As of November 2010, member of the Supreme Audit Office Board.

Mr. Jacek Barylski graduated from the Law and Administration Faculty at the University of Łódź. Postgraduate studies in finance at the Warsaw School of Economics. Legal Advisor. Currently, Head of Guarantee Department in the Ministry of Finance, also acts as a Head of the Steering Committee at the Governmental Program supporting private enterprises using sureties and guarantees of Bank Gospodarstwa Krajowego.. Former member of the supervisory boards at: Polski Monopol Loteryjny Sp. z o.o., PKP Cargo S.A. and Warszawski Rolno – Spożywczy Rynek Hurtowy S.A. As of 2003 member of the Supervisory Board at PKP S.A.

Mr. Czesław Grzesiak graduated from the University of Poznań Faculty of Law and Administration, majoring in law. Completed course for insolvency trustees. He is a member of the management boards at “Lewiatan” Private Employers' Confederation and Polish Organization of Commerce and Distribution.
As of 1995 member of the Management Board, and as of 2004 Vice President of the Management Board of TESCO (Polska) Sp. z o.o. (current place of main employment). President of the management boards at: Savia – Karpaty Sp. z o.o., Genesis Sp. z o.o., and Promesa Sp. z o.o. Vice-President of the management board at Kabaty Investments Tesco (Polska) Sp. z o.o. Sp.k. and a member of the management boards at Tesco Dystrybucja Sp. z o.o. and Jasper Sp. z o.o.

Mr. Grzegorz Krystek graduated from the Warsaw University of Technology, Faculty of Electrical Engineering as well as from leading European Universities: London Business School, HEC in Paris, Norwegian School of Economics and Business Administration in Bergen (MBA). Participated in privatization and restructuring projects in the energy sector in Poland and abroad. Cooperated with New York State Electric & Gas Corporation, Westinghouse, Apache Corporation and market regulators in USA. At Arthur Andersen led projects in energy sector. Advised to a number of foreign investors. Advised to the Ministry of State Treasury in privatization processes in the sector. As a Head of Strategy and Energy Department at Elektrim S.A. responsible for financing arrangements and construction of Pątnów II power plant as well as restructuring of the Elektrim Group and energy assets portfolio management. Co-author of the National Emission Reduction Plan. At Vertis Environmental Finance introduced and developed secondary market for emission allowances in Europe. Expert in the Council of European Energy Regulators (CEER). Consultant to a number of entities from the energy sector in the fields of electricity trading model, restructuring, strategy and common practices in operational management. As of 2004 Vice-President at Hasbrouck Sp. z o.o. Member of the supervisory boards at: ZA PAK S.A., Elektrim Megadex S.A., Elektrim – Volt S.A., EM Yachts Sp. z o.o. Current main place of employment – “Partner” enterprise.
